An intuitive proof of the Dvoretzky-Hanani theorem in R^2
Abstract
The Dvoretzky-Hanani theorem states that the general term of any perfectly divergent series in a finite dimensional space does not tend to zero. An intuitive proof is provided R2 using a construction that allows us to determine a choice of +/- such that $$a_1 +/- a_2 +/- a_3 +/- a_4... +/- a_n...$$ converges to a point in the space if ||a_i|| goes to 0. Extensions to the construction are proposed for the general R^n.
